Ready to turn your passion for art into a successful future? Whether you choose to pursue Marist’s B.S. in Studio Art or a concentration in Studio Art through our B.A. in Fine Arts, we have the tools, resources, faculty, and facilities to prepare you for a successful career after graduation.

Meet Fine Arts Major, Bridget
A major in fine arts with concentrations in studio art and art history and a minor in photography, Bridget Stevens explored woodworking, ceramics, oil painting, and printmaking mediums while at Marist. Much of her artwork includes plants, animals, and natural elements, aiming to capture the beauty of nature while also conveying the complexity of the human mind. She participated in various exhibitions, including the Senior Exhibition titled "IDENTITY." She also co-curated an exhibit titled "Canvas & Vinyl" which featured her work with other fellow senior art students.
Customize Your Studio Art Curriculum
The variety of Studio Art programs available to you as a Marist student allows you to develop a curriculum that is best for your interests in career goals. You can either pursue one of two Studio Art programs:
- B.S. in Studio Art: hone your skills and harness your artistic potential with this carefully structured series of courses organized to broaden your understanding, aesthetic awareness, and technical abilities in the studio arts
- B.S. in Fine Arts with a concentration in Studio Art: an excellent option for students who are planning to double-major or have multiple minors; also encourages customization in specialty tracks: Digital Media, Drawing, Graphic Design, Painting, or Photography
Broaden Your Horizons at the Venice Biennale
Along with the Studio Art program's emphasis on international study and access to our Marist in Manhattan internship program in New York City, our students also gain exposure to arguably the most important art exhibition in the world–the Venice Biennale. The Marist Biennale program is a four-week intensive immersion program in the Studio Arts in the Venice Biennale. Venice has the quality of being a living museum, and when our Studio Art students arrive in Venice, they are immediately artistically inspired and driven. You’re More Than a Number
The art faculty at Marist is composed of full-time and visiting art professionals who are committed to creating a nurturing but challenging environment in which you can explore, experiment, and develop their own personal visions. With small classes and personalized attention, you’re never just a number at Marist. Studio classes are never larger than 20 students, with enrollment in most limited to 15.
